Is the rust of an iron nail a compound?

Iron (Not rusted) is an element. However, when iron is in contact with air and water, rust will form on its surface. Rust is an oxide of iron and rust is a compound. Since rust is red/brown in colour it means that the iron has been oxidised to oxidation state '3'. , by the action of water and air. The chemical symbol form iron is Fe (Ferrum - Latin) The chemical formula for rust is Fe2O3 (Ferric oxide). There are other oxides of iron . They are FeO (ferrous oxide = green in colour) and Fe3O4 ( magnetite - grey/black in colour)

Is rust an element or an compound?

Rust is a compound, or more often in practice, a mixture of compounds. The major constituent is Fe2O3, but rust usually also includes at least small amounts of FeO and iron hydroxides with varying degrees of hydration.
